- Press the Download button above to save the skin as a PNG file.
- Minecraft: Bedrock Edition (PE): open the Dressing Room from the main menu (or tap your character → Edit Character), go to Classic Skins → Owned, press the + (new skin) button, choose the downloaded PNG and pick the Classic (Steve) model. Works on PC and mobile; consoles cannot import custom skins.
- Minecraft: Java Edition: open the Minecraft Launcher, go to the Skins tab, click New Skin, load the PNG, pick the Classic (Steve) model and press Save & Use. You can also upload it at minecraft.net → Profile → Change Skin.
The skin does not show up after import - what should I do?
Restart Minecraft and open the Dressing Room again - imported skins sometimes appear only after a restart. Also make sure you selected the imported skin and picked the Classic (Steve) model.
Which model should I choose, Classic or Slim?
This skin is designed for the Classic (Steve) model. If you pick the wrong model, the arms of the skin will look stretched or squeezed.
Is the skin of Kyvernal free to download?
Yes. Press Download, save the PNG file and use it in Minecraft: Bedrock Edition or Java Edition - no payment or registration needed. The skin also works on multiplayer servers and Realms.
